Tour of HD HHI Shipyard in Ulsan, South Korea

Показать описание
Naval News takes you on an exclusive tour of the HD Hyundai Heavy Industries (HHI) shipyard in Ulsan, South Korea. Established in 1972, HD HHI's Ulsan shipyard today is one of the largest shipbuilding facility in the world. The yard spans across 6.8 km² and employs close to 63,000 workers.
During our visit to the Naval and Special Ship unit, we could tour ROKS Jeongjo the Great (the first KDX III Batch II destroyer), ROKS Chungnam (the first FFX Batch III frigate) and the area dedicated to the production and maintenance of submarines.
The visit took place in late November 2024.
